OCPS470 from what i have read in the early days eddie used an older 100wt marshall (maybe a plexi) with a voltage regularol cranking the ac voltage to 145 volts. his guitar was an older strat fitted with with hardware from charvel. charvel was a guitar parts company and didn't build guitars until eddy called his strat a charvel. he also used a les paul
